The Mechanics of Repairing Chipped Windshields

So, what exactly happens when you get a chip in your windshield? The science behind it is quite fascinating. When a chip occurs, it creates a stress point in the glass, which can lead to further damage if left untreated. The repair process typically involves using a specialized resin to fill the chip, and then applying a protective coating to prevent future damage.

For individuals who drive regularly, a repaired chip can save you time and money in the long run. For those who value convenience, many repair shops offer mobile services, where technicians come to you to repair your windshield.

For DIY enthusiasts, there are various repair kits available on the market, which can be a cost-effective option. However, it’s essential to note that improper repair techniques can lead to further damage or even safety issues. For those who are unsure, it’s always best to consult a professional.
